Rockrose Oasis: Creating a Focal Point

Implementation 🌱 ((difficulty:easy))

To kick off your Rockrose oasis, start by selecting a sunny spot in your garden. Purple Rockrose thrives in full sun, so this is crucial for optimal growth.

Next, cluster 3-5 plants together. This grouping creates a striking focal point that draws the eye.

Consider surrounding your cluster with gravel or decorative stones. This not only enhances the visual impact but also helps with drainage.

Why It Works 🌼

The vibrant blooms of Purple Rockrose stand out beautifully against a backdrop of greenery. This contrast creates a stunning visual centerpiece that captures attention and elevates your garden's aesthetic.

Adaptation for Different Garden Sizes 🌳

In small gardens, a single cluster of Purple Rockrose can make a bold statement. For larger spaces, expand the cluster or create multiple oases throughout the landscape to maintain visual interest.

This versatility allows you to tailor your garden design to fit any size, ensuring that your Rockrose oasis shines no matter the scale.

Colorful Borders: Vibrant Pathway Edges

Implementation 🌱

Planting Purple Rockrose along pathways or garden beds is a fantastic way to enhance your landscape. Space these vibrant plants 2-3 feet apart to allow for their natural growth and spread.

Consider using a mix of colors for a stunning gradient effect. Alternatively, sticking to a single color can create a more cohesive and uniform look that ties the garden together.

Why It Works πŸŽ‰

The colorful blooms of Purple Rockrose serve as a lively border, adding energy to your garden design. They not only beautify the space but also guide visitors along pathways, making the journey through your garden more enjoyable.

Adaptation for Different Garden Styles 🌼

In modern gardens, straight lines can create a sleek and polished appearance. For rustic settings, embrace a more organic, meandering layout that complements the natural flow of the landscape.

Container Garden Delight: Patio Plants

Implementation 🌱

Choosing the right containers is key to showcasing Purple Rockrose. Opt for large, decorative pots that not only provide ample space for growth but also add aesthetic appeal to your patio.

Soil and Sunlight β˜€οΈ

Ensure you use well-draining soil to keep the roots healthy. Place your containers in full sun, as these plants thrive in bright conditions, making your outdoor space vibrant.

Why It Works πŸŽ‰

Container gardening offers incredible flexibility. You can easily rearrange your setup, allowing for a dynamic and colorful patio that can change with the seasons.

Adaptation for Various Garden Sizes 🏑

For smaller balconies, select compact containers that won’t overwhelm the space. In contrast, larger patios can benefit from grouping multiple containers, creating a striking visual impact.
